Chapter Two

Chapter Two

Rachel took extra care in dressing for her first day with Scott Haynes. She was so beyond nervous, that she had changed clothes four times already. Hallie had finally told her that she’d disown her as a best friend, if she changed one more time. She gathered her camera and her bag, and said goodbye to her friend. She was supposed to meet the professor in the classroom before going to Haynes’s offices. She supposed that she was going to be told that she needed to be on her best behavior, as if she didn’t know that. She was cutting it really close, she took off in a trot to get there on time. When she did get their, her red hair was everywhere. She normally had it put up, but she’d decided that she should leave it down. She quickly ran a brush through and was about to go through the doors, when a girl she didn’t recognize came up behind her.

“ Hathaway, who the hell did you sleep with to get the top spot? You’ve always been the professor’s favorite, and now I’m not the only one who hates you.” Rachel didn’t take time to find out who she was, because she was running really late. When she entered the room, the class grew eerily silent. All of them were looking at them, and the air was faintly hostile. Instead of taking her normal seat in the back, she chose one in the front.

Professor Lawrence stood up from behind her desk, and smiled at the class. She knew that everyone was nervous, especially Rachel. She’d gotten the top spot, and would therefore be interning with Scott Haynes. She knew that the other students were resenting her right now, but most of them would get over it once they started their own internships. She looked around the class and began to address them all.

“ I assume that since you are all here that you’ve seen who you will be interning with. Every artist is extremely talented and you must show them the respect they deserve. You all have your instructions and your directions. I want you to know that they will be filling me in for all of next semester, so behave. Most importantly, though, I want you to have fun. You may all go, but Rachel if you could stay behind a moment.” As everyone filed out of the room, it was as if they were all glaring at her. She walked up the professor’s desk, and waited. Once everyone was out of the room, she turned to face her with a smile on her face.

“ You did fabulous on your paper, you know. I had a feeling that you were going to give me something extraordinary. I’m afraid that I’ve made you late, but I wanted you to know that I thought you did excellent work. Tell Scott that I held you over, okay? I do hope you know that he’s probably going to give you a hard time at first.” Rachel sighed and nodded. She had figured since she got the top spot, that she was going to be used as a secretary at first. When at last the professor let her go, she walked out of the room. She was going to be almost an hour late on her first day, and she knew that Mr. Haynes wasn’t going to be happy about this.

Rachel walked into the outer office of Haynes offices. She hadn’t been quite as late as she had thought, but it was close to it. There was a receptionist behind a plain desk when she walked in. She walked up the desk, but the girl acted as if she didn’t see her. She cleared her throat, but the girl still ignored her. She looked around the desk to see if she was supposed to sign something, and when she didn’t see anything, she got more than a little annoyed.

“ Excuse me, I’m Rachel Hathaway. I’m the intern for Mr. Haynes.” The girl placed the magazine she’d been reading down on the desk, and stared at her for a minute.

“ Are you really? Because I was under the impression that you were supposed to be here over forty-five minutes ago. Mr. Haynes does not like to be kept waiting, and it’s seriously not a good thing to do on your first day. Have a seat, and I’ll page him to see if he still wants to use you.” She then picked up the phone and dialed a short number. She was on the phone for a while, and hung up.

Rachel was starting to get extremely nervous, because she wasn’t saying anything to her. She knew she was late, but it wasn’t her fault. Her professor told her that it would be fine as long as she told him she was the reason he was late. She looked at the clock and saw that it now said 10:15 a.m. She was supposed to have been back there at nine, and she had the distinct feeling that she was going to get sacked before she even had the opportunity to start. After another five minutes or so, the door to Mr. Haynes office opened, and they guy who had been in her class the other day emerged. At first she thought he was just here talking to him, but she soon saw that he was in fact Mr. Haynes. She looked down and sighed to herself, knowing this was not going to be as good a day as she thought it would. After talking to his secretary for a few moments, he walked over to where she was sitting. His face was expressionless as he looked at her. He sat down in the seat next to her, and didn’t say anything for a few seconds.

“ You’re late, you know. I realize that it’s possible you could have gotten lost, but I think you’d have at least phoned. When I saw your photograph and your report, I knew I had to have you as my intern. I wasn’t expecting you be lazy, though. What I’m trying to say is, I don’t know if this is going to work out.” Rachel looked at him with an astonished look on her face. She stood up and gathered her things. She wasn’t going to work with someone as arrogant as this man appeared to be. She was going to tell him what for, then she was going to get Professor Lawrence to change her with someone else.

“ I’ll have you know that Professor Lawrence kept over after class today. She told me to tell you that it was because of her that I was late, but now I don’t care if you believe me or not. You sit there telling me how lazy I must be, and that I’m irresponsible. You don’t know me, and frankly I don’t want you to. I was looking forward to working with you, because I’m a big fan of your work. I had no idea, however, what an arrogant ass you were. I only say this, because you clearly had no intention of letting me explain why I was late. Now, if you’ll excuse me, I’m going back to professor Lawrence, and I’m going to have her place me somewhere else. I hope you have a very rotten day.” After saying this, she marched away from him, leaving in an angry tiff.

Scott couldn’t be more pleased with her, and he hadn’t even had the chance to tell her so. This had been his way of testing her, because he didn’t want anyone who didn’t have a backbone. It was rather refreshing to have someone call you names to your face like that, because most people just fawned over him. He turned back to his secretary who was trying not to laugh at him. He grinned at her, and told her to get Professor Lawrence on the phone. He couldn’t wait to start working with her. He knew that it was going to be two months before they actually started their work, but he needed her to come back in so he could go over the ground rules with her. When he had Professor Lawrence on the phone, Rachel hadn’t yet gotten to her. He recounted the whole scene to her, and she seemed to think it was rather funny too. He explained that he definitely wanted her to be his intern, and to have come back tomorrow at the same time.

Rachel was still fuming when she entered the photography hall. The hallway that was usually bustling, was now deserted. She walked into the classroom, and found her professor behind her desk. When she saw Rachel, she showed no surprise whatsoever. She merely motioned for her to sit in a chair that had been placed in front of her desk. Once Rachel had sat down, Professor Lawrence started to speak.

“ I understand that you didn’t have a good third meeting with Mr. Haynes. I spoke with him on the phone about fifteen minutes ago. I do believe, Ms. Hathaway, that I specifically stated show them some respect. I let you meet him prior because I wanted you to get used to him. I probably should have told you who he was, but I thought it was kind of funny. I’m not mad, and frankly neither is Scott. He’s actually very amused by you, and wants you to come back tomorrow.” Rachel’s mouth dropped open in disbelief.

“ You don’t honestly think I’ll back over there, after the way him and his secretary treated me. I know you said respect, but they showed me none, and I’m of the mind you have to earn it to get it.” Professor Lawrence just smiled at her.

“ Rachel, let me be honest. He was seeing if you’d do exactly what you did. He wanted ruffle your feathers, and it would appear he succeeded. I don’t have another position available to you, so he is your only option if you want to pass. I suggest that you get to that office in the morning, and lay down your own ground rules just as he’s going to. Just because you’re his intern, doesn’t mean he can order you do absolutely everything. I’m dead serious about this being my only position, though. You have to take it or leave it.” Rachel sighed with frustration.

“ I don’t guess I have any choice in the matter, do I?” Professor Lawrence smiled and shook her head. Rachel nodded and stood up. She said goodbye to her, and left the room.

On her way to her dorm room, she mulled over in her head exactly what she was going to say Scott Haynes once she got there tomorrow. She’d tell him that he wasn’t going to treat her like that ever again. With this thought in her head, she continued to her room, still fuming over her day.
